About The Position

Project Manager (Construction / Fiber Infrastructure) Our client is seeking a hands-on Project Manager to lead the full lifecycle of construction projects across multiple sites in Europe. This is a high-impact role for a strong builder and organizer who thrives in fast-paced environments, can keep projects moving on schedule and on budget, and knows how to lead teams with clarity, urgency, and respect. You’ll be the key point of contact from kickoff through closeout—setting up site infrastructure, coordinating labor/materials/equipment, driving quality and safety standards, and ensuring smooth communication between internal teams, contractors, and stakeholders.

Responsibilities

  • Project Planning & Execution
  • Develop detailed project plans including timelines, resources, and quality expectations
  • Oversee on-site setup (access points, equipment, workflows) to ensure operational readiness
  • Manage scope, schedules, and budgets—adjusting plans as needed to meet changing requirements
  • Track daily progress, remove obstacles, and quickly resolve delays/issues
  • Ensure work meets internal standards and external regulations/specs
  • Resource & Workforce Management
  • Coordinate labor, materials, and equipment across multiple project sites
  • Assign tasks to site managers, supervisors, and contractors; ensure alignment and accountability
  • Manage mobile crews and travel logistics (flights, accommodations, scheduling)
  • Support hiring, onboarding, and project staffing decisions as needed
  • Client & Stakeholder Leadership
  • Serve as the primary point of contact—providing project updates and managing expectations
  • Lead kickoff meetings, progress reviews, and closeouts to ensure satisfaction and feedback
  • Build strong working relationships across internal teams, vendors, and field leaders
  • Negotiate timelines, budgets, and deliverables when needed while protecting quality standards
  • Quality, Compliance & Safety
  • Conduct inspections and quality checks to ensure standards are met
  • Proactively manage safety risks and enforce PPE and safety protocols
  • Maintain accurate documentation: checklists, signoffs, inspection reports
  • Financial Oversight & Reporting
  • Monitor expenses and control costs across labor, materials, and equipment
  • Track purchase orders and keep projects aligned to financial targets
  • Provide reporting on project performance, budget status, and resource allocation
